How Does PinPointe Laser Work?

PinPointe uses a focused beam of light that passes through the toenail to the nail bed where the fungus resides. This specific wavelength is absorbed by the fungus, gently heating and destroying the fungal cells without harming surrounding skin or healthy nail tissue.

 

Because the laser works through the nail, there is no need to remove the nail or use needles. This non-invasive approach fits the surgery-free philosophy at Restore Podiatry & Laser Center, allowing your body to naturally grow a new, clear nail over time.

 

Toenail fungus is hard to clear because it lives deep beneath the nail, where creams often cannot reach. Laser energy reaches the hidden infection directly, which is what makes it more appealing than older methods.

 

What Conditions Does PinPointe Laser Treat?

PinPointe is designed specifically to treat onychomycosis, the medical term for toenail fungus. This infection causes nail issues that make many people hide their feet, including:

  • Thick, brittle, or crumbly nails

  • Yellow, brown, or white discoloration

  • Distorted nail shape

  • Debris buildup under the nail

  • Nails lifting away from the nail bed

 

Laser treatment is a good option for people who:

  • Have tried creams or topical treatments without success

  • Cannot or prefer not to take oral antifungal medication

  • Want a non-invasive treatment with little downtime

  • Have several infected nails

 

Toenail fungus is different from other foot conditions like athlete’s foot or ingrown toenails, though these can sometimes appear together. A proper evaluation makes sure laser therapy is the right match.

How Soon Will I See Improvement?

Visible results appear at the speed of nail growth. The laser kills the fungus immediately, but the damaged, discolored nail must grow out and be replaced by a new, healthy nail.

  • Most patients notice a clear line of new growth within a few months

  • A full cycle of nail growth takes about 6-8 months

  • Steady follow-up gives you the strongest chance of seeing improvement

 

Safety and Comfort of PinPointe Laser Treatment

 

Is the Treatment Painful?

The vast majority of patients report no pain. You may feel a gentle warming or slight tingling sensation as the laser passes over the nail, but it is typically well tolerated. There are no needles and no cutting involved.

 

Because the treatment is non-invasive, there is no downtime. You can return to your normal day right after your appointment – putting your shoes back on and heading to work.

 

Is PinPointe Laser Safe?

PinPointe laser is a very safe, targeted therapy. The energy is precisely calibrated to affect only the fungal organisms, leaving healthy skin and tissue unharmed.
